Growing up, Jillian wondered why Sarnia had very few historical buildings and such little character. As she started doing research, Jillian came across an abundance of beautiful building and structures.  These buildings once stood in the place of Sarnia’s now vacant, depressing Downtown core that was once flourishing. People actually enjoyed visiting “Old Sarnia”. A great deal of damage occurred in 1953 when a tornado tore through the Town.  Many of these historical buildings were never reconstructed.

@ Gallery Lambton - Gallery Lambton Main Gallery - Up Close and Personal 3 Opens July 2, 2010, Reception 6:00 p.m. to 9:00 p.m. Curator talk at 7:30 pm  Curator talk at 7:30 pm Take the opportunity to experience the heart and soul of Sarnia-Lambton’s art gallery - its permanent collection. Many of our treasures will be on view including works by members of the Group of Seven and their contemporaries: Harris; A.Y. Jackson; Lismer and Emily Carr. More recent artists will also be featured including: Christopher and Mary Pratt; Jack Chambers; and Guido Molinari.
